资源描述:
《基于java技术的网络论坛的实现(doc毕业设计论文)》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、基于JSP技术的网络论坛摘要随着Internet的飞速发展,机关、学校、公司、企业都已经或正在建立自己的网站和论坛,而一个真正的、完善的论坛离不开web数据库技术,web数据库技术可以实现浏览器与数据库的双向交互。web技术和数据库相互融合领域的研究已成为热点方向之一,web技术和数据库技术都发生了质的变化,web网页由静态网页发展成了动态网页,数据库实现了开发环境和应用环境的分离,用户端可以用相对统一的浏览器实现跨平台和多媒体服务。本文主要完成了基于JSP技术的信息交流学习的设计和实现,主要实现了客户端和服务器端的动态交互。该系统包含用户系统功能
2、模块和管理员管理功能模块.用户系统功能模块包含注册、登陆、个人贴子管理、搜索帖子、回复帖子,浏览帖子等功能,管理员功能模块包含用户信息管理,版面管理,公共信息管理,帖子管理等功能。系统采用了JSP技术以及JavaBeans组件技术和JDBC技术来连接MYSQL数据库实现的。关键词:论坛;网站设计;JSP;MYSQL;JavaBeansOnlineBBSBasedonJSPTechnologyAbstractWiththerapiddevelopmentofInternet,offices,schools,companies,enterprisesh
3、avebeenorarebeingsetuptheirownwebsitesandforums,andatrueandperfectforumforWebdatabasetechnologycannotbeseparated,Webdatabasetechnologyenablesthebrowserandthedatabasetwo-wayinteraction.Webtechnologyanddatabaseintegrationbetweenresearchinthefieldhasbecomeahotonedirection,Webdata
4、basetechnologytomakeWebtechnologyanddatabasetechnologyhaveundergoneaqualitativechange:Webpagesfromstaticpagesintodynamicwebpagedevelopment,databaseandapplicationdevelopmentenvironmenttoachieveseparationoftheenvironment,clientscanusethebrowsertoachieverelativelyuniformcross-pla
5、tformandmultimediaservices.Inthistext,itbasedonJSPtechnologytocompletetheexchangeofinformationonthedesignandimplementationofthestudy,themainachievementoftheclientandserver-sidedynamicinteraction.Thesystemincludesauser'ssystemadministratorstomanagemodulesandfunctionmodules.User
6、systemmodulesincluderegistration,login,personalpostmanagement,andsearchmessages,replymessages,browsethepostsandotherfeatures,theadministratorfunctionmodulecontainstheuserinformationmanagement,layoutmanagement,publicinformationmanagement,messagemanagementandotherfunctions.Syste
7、musestheJSPtechnology,andJavaBeanstechnologycomponentstechnologyandJDBCtoconnecttotheMYSQLdatabase.Keywords:BBS;WebsiteDesignJSP;MYSQL;JavaBeans;目录1绪论11.1课题背景11.2系统简介11.3项目中涉及的技术11.3.1JSP技术11.3.2JavaBeans技术21.3.3JDBC技术22系统分析42.1系统需求分析42.2数据流图42.2.1系统顶层DFD图42.2.2系统一层DFD图52.3系统功
8、能描述62.3.1主要功能62.4系统设计72.5开发环境的选择102.6研究方法103总体设计123.1B/S设计模式1